Lula Seeks Extradition of Former Intelligence Chief from US

Brazilian President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va has requested the United States to extradite former intelligence chief Alexandre Ramagem, who was detained by US Immigration and Customs Enforcement in Florida. Ramagem fled Brazil in September after being sentenced to 16 years in prison for his role in a coup plot supporting former president Jair Bolsonaro. Lula expressed optimism about Ramagem's return to serve his sentence. Bolsonaro's allies have downplayed the detention, suggesting it was a routine traffic stop. Ramagem is also accused of spying on political rivals during his tenure as head of Brazil's intelligence agency. The US and Brazil recently announced a partnership to combat drug and weapons trafficking.
